Exploring ASUS SSD Design and Advanced Troubleshooting Approaches
ASUS incorporates state-of-the-art NAND flash SSDs into lines like VivoBook and ROG, delivering swift access times and durability that outpace conventional HDDs, perfect for demanding regional tasks. However, Niagara's fluctuating weather and power inconsistencies can strain these components, impacting controller reliability and cell endurance over time.
Our JTG Systems technicians start evaluations with thorough firmware checks and S.M.A.R.T. data analysis to pinpoint issues early, using precision instruments to examine connections such as SATA and NVMe prevalent in ASUS builds for precise assessments.

Pro Tips for Sustaining ASUS SSD Vitality
Adopt these practices to fortify your ASUS SSD against Niagara's tough conditions, extending reliability into 2025 and beyond.
- Activate system TRIM and cleanup routines for efficient area handling.
- Incorporate extra ventilation for intensive activities such as graphic design.
- Keep ASUS system software and SSD updates current from trusted sources.
- Shift bulky data to secondary drives to ease flash stress.
- Check status every few months using tools like CrystalDiskInfo for early warnings.
- Deploy power stabilizers to counter Niagara's common disruptions.
- Plan periodic declutters to avoid data scattering.
- Adjust ASUS energy settings to reduce SSD load.
- Establish routine auto-saves to remote or backup storage.
- Book yearly evaluations at JTG Systems for expert evaluations.
- Shield from bumps with padded transport for area moves.
- Optimize software to limit unnecessary write logs.
- Store away from humidity swings in variable weather.
- Leverage ASUS management software for optimal balance modes.
- Verify SSD condition after significant hardware shifts.
- Avoid running defrag on solid-state drives.
- Monitor temperatures during extended use in warm offices.
- Use quality cables for external connections.
These steps can significantly surpass typical SSD durability benchmarks.
